MozillaTranslator allows to export the entire translation directory&files hierarchy, but mirrors the original CVS en-US hierarchy, which differs than the L10n one. It would be nice if MT could be told about the correspondences between en-US and L10n directories and respect them.

I have some ideas and will try to implement them.
